*{ margin:0; padding:0; border:0;}
body{margin:0 auto; width:100%; background:url(imagesbody.jpg) no-repeat top;font-size:12px; font-family:"微软雅黑"}
ul li,ol li{ list-style-type:none;}
input,select{ border:1px #ccc solid;}
h2,h3{ font-size:14px;}
img{ display:block;}
a{color:#000; text-decoration:none;}
a:hover{ color:#f00; text-decoration:none;}
.top{ width:960px; margin:0 auto;}
.kg{margin-top:10px;}
.jj{margin:10px;}
#menu_out{width:963px;padding-left:4px;margin-left:auto;margin-right:auto;background:url(imagesnav_l.gif) no-repeat left top;}
#menu_in{background:url(imagesnav_r.gif) no-repeat right top;padding-right:4px;}
.nav{background:url(imagesnav_bg.gif) repeat-x;height:43px; line-height:43px}
.search{ width:950px; margin:0 auto; height:35px; line-height:35px; display:table;}
.login{ float:left; margin-top:4px; margin-left:20px;_margin-left:10px;}
.login b,.sea b{ color:#077407; font-size:13px; float:left; margin-right:6px;}
.login kbd{ float:left; margin:0 5px;}
.sea select{ float:left; margin-top:5px;}
.login input,.sea input{ width:100px; height:19px; line-height:19px; margin:5px 3px 0 0; float:left;}
.login span input{ background:url(imageslogin.jpg); width:66px; height:23px; border:none;margin-left:5px;}
.sea{ float:left; margin:4px 0 0 100px;}
.sea span input{ background:url(imagessearch.jpg); width:68px; height:23px; border:none; margin-left:5px;}
.main{ width:960px; margin:3px auto; background:#fff; display:table;}
.news{ margin:6px auto; width:950px; display:table;}
.content{ margin:0 auto; width:950px; display:table;padding-top:10px}
.flash{ width:270px; background:#55C663; float:left;height:220px;height:216px\9;*height:220px;_height:220px;text-align:center; display:table; }
.flash_pic{ margin:5px auto;margin:3px auto\9;*margin:5px auto;_margin:5px auto; display:block;}
.news_list{ float:left; width:677px; border:1px #C1D5AF solid; margin-left:8px; height:218px; display:table;}
.news_a{ background:url(imagesnews_bg.jpg); width:677px; height:28px; line-height:28px; display:table;}
.news_a span a{ background:url(imagesnews_a.gif); width:69px; height:28px; text-align:center; margin:0 2px; line-height:28px; float:left;}
.news_a span{ float:left;}
.news_a kbd{ background: url(../images/news_more.jpg); width:126px; height:26px; float:right;}
.news_a kbd a{ float:right; margin-right:6px; color:#fff;}
.news_a .kjy_a{ background: url(imagesnews_cho.jpg); font-weight:bold; width:79px; height:28px; line-height:28px; text-align:center;}
.news_b{ width:100%; background:url(imagesnot_bg.jpg) repeat-x top; display:table;}
.news_b ul{ margin:8px 10px 6px 10px; width:430px; line-height:22px;*line-height:18px; display:table;}
.news_b ul li a{ margin-left:10px; float:left;}
.news_b ul li span{ float:right;}
.notice{ float:right; width:196px; border:1px #C1D5AF solid;  height:218px; display:table;}
.not{ float:right; width:196px; border:1px #C1D5AF solid;  height:174px; display:table;}
.notice h2,.not h2{ background:url(imagesnot_h2.jpg); width:196px; height:28px; line-height:28px;}
.notice h2 span,.not h2 span{ float:left; margin-left:6px; color:#fff;}
.notice h2 a,.video h2 a,.lx h2 a,.leader h2 a,.main_r h2 a,.not h2 a{ float:right; margin-right:6px; font-size:12px; font-weight:normal; color:#000;}
.notice ul,.not ul { padding:7px 10px; width:176px; background:url(imagesnot_bg.jpg) repeat-x top; line-height:22px; display:table;}
.notice ul li,.news_b ul li ,.video ul li,.lx ul li,.leader ul li,.not ul li{ background:url(imagesicon_1.gif) no-repeat left; width:100%; display:table;}
.notice ul li a,.video ul li a,.lx ul li a,.leader ul li a,.not ul li a{ margin-left:10px;}
.cont_left{ width:227px; float:left; display:table;}
.email{ background:url(imagesemail.jpg); width:227px; height:77px; display:table;}
.email ul li{ float:left; margin:45px 10px 0 10px;}
.video{ border:1px #C1D5AF solid; width:225px; height:176px; margin-top:6px; display:table; }
.video h2{ background:url(imagesvideo_h2.jpg); width:225px; height:28px; line-height:28px; display:table;}
.video h2 span,.lx h2 span,.leader h2 span{ color:#fff; margin-left:10px; float:left;}
.video ul { padding:8px 10px; width:205px; background:url(imagesnot_bg.jpg) repeat-x top; line-height:22px; display:table;}
.lx{ width:247px;border:1px #C1D5AF solid; height:174px; float:left; display:table;}
.lx h2,.leader h2{background:url(imagesleader.jpg); width:247px; height:174px; height:28px; line-height:28px;}
.leader{ width:247px;border:1px #C1D5AF solid; float:left;height:174px; margin-left:9px; display:table;}
.lx ul,.leader ul{ padding:7px 10px; width:227px;background:url(imagesnot_bg.jpg) repeat-x top; line-height:22px; display:table;}
.ban{ width:100%; margin-top:6px; display:table;}
.ban img{margin-top:0; margin-top:6px\9;*margin-top:0;}
.cont_rig{ float:right; width:715px; display:table;}
.cont_rig1{ width:715px; display:table;}
.online{ width:950px; margin:6px auto; display:table; }
.online ol{ float:left;}
.online ul{ float:left;background:url(imagessevice_bg.jpg) repeat-x; height:90px; width:768px; display:table;}
.online ul li{ float:left; margin-top:7px;}
.main_l{ float:left; width:232px; display:table;}
.main_l h2{ background:url(imagesbk_bg.jpg); width:230px; height:28px; line-height:28px; color:#fff; text-indent:10px;}
.lybk{ width:230px; border:1px #C1D5AF solid; height:195px; display:table;}
.link{ width:230px; border:1px #C1D5AF solid; height:154px;*height:158px; display:table;}
.lybk ul,.lssy ul,.link ul,.dc dl{background:url(imagesnot_bg.jpg) repeat-x top;width:210px;padding:6px 10px;display:table;}
.lybk ul li,.lssy ul li{ background:url(imagesbk_li.jpg); text-align:center; width:99px; height:65px; line-height:22px; float:left; margin:8px 3px;_margin:5px 2px 5px;}
.lybk ul li img,.lssy ul li img{ margin:10px auto 5px;}
.lybk ul li a,.lssy ul li a{ font-weight:bold;}
.link ul { text-align:center;}
.link ul li{ margin:6px auto;*margin:-4px auto;_margin:-11px auto -10px; display:block;}
.lssy{width:230px; margin:6px 0; border:1px #C1D5AF solid; height:195px;_height:193px;display:table;}
.dc{width:230px; border:1px #C1D5AF solid;height:190px;height:190px\9;*height:198px; margin-top:6px; display:table;}
.dc dl{ line-height:25px;}
.dc dl dd{width:210px; display:table;border-bottom:1px #25BB1C dotted; padding-bottom:4px;*padding-bottom:6px;}
.dc dl dt{ border-bottom:1px #25BB1C dotted; padding-bottom:6px;}
.dc dl dd span{width:210px; border-bottom:none; display:table;}
.dc dl input{ border:none;}
.dc dl dd span input{ background:url(imagesvote_bg.jpg); width:80px; height:23px; color:#fff; font-size:12px; text-align:center; line-height:23px; border:1px #25BB1C solid; margin:2px 6px 0;margin:2px 6px 0\9;*margin:10px 6px;_margin:8px 6px 0;}
#none{ border-bottom:none;}
.main_m{ float:left; width:709px; margin-left:8px; display:table;}
.file,.zcfg,.lygc{ border:1px #C1D5AF solid; width:708px; height:184px; display:table;}
.zcfg{ margin:6px 0;}
.zwdh{ border:1px #C1D5AF solid; margin-top:6px; height:170px; width:708px; display:table;}
.file_a,.lygc h2,.zwdh h2{ background:url(imagesfile_bg.jpg); width:708px; height:28px; line-height:28px; display:table;}
.file_a img,.lygc h2 img,.zwdh h2 img{ float:left; margin:5px 10px 0 10px;}
.file_a kbd,.lygc h2 span,.zwdh h2 span{ float:left; color:#239001; font-weight:bold; margin-right:20px; font-size:14px; }
.file_a span a{ background:url(imagesfile_a.jpg); width:70px; height:24px; line-height:24px; text-align:center; float:left; margin:1px 2px 0 ;} 
.file_a a{ float:right; margin-right:6px;}
.file_a .kjy_a{ background:url(imagesfile_cho.jpg); width:66px; height:24px; line-height:24px; color:#fff;}
.file_b{ margin:6px 10px; width:480px; display:table;}
.file_b ul{ width:230px; float:left; display:table; line-height:24px;}
.lygc ul{ margin:6px 0 6px 10px;_margin:6px 0 6px 5px; width:230px; float:left; line-height:24px; display:table; }
.file_b ol,.lygc ol{ float:right; width:230px; border-left:1px #ccc dotted; padding-left:10px; display:table; line-height:24px;}
.lygc ol{ margin:6px 10px 6px 0;_margin:6px 0 6px 0; width:230px;}
.file_b ul li,.file_b ol li,.lygc ul li,.lygc ol li{background:url(imagesicon_1.gif) no-repeat left; width:230px;}
.file_b ul li a,.file_b ol li a,.lygc ul li a,.lygc ol li a{ margin-left:10px;}
.lygc h2 kbd,.zwdh h2 kbd{ background:url(imagesfile_more.jpg) no-repeat top; width:228px; height:25px; float:right;}
.lygc h2 kbd a,.zwdh h2 kbd a{ float:right; font-size:12px; font-weight:normal; margin-right:6px;}
.zwdh dl{ float:left; width:220px;_width:220px; margin:5px 5px; display:table;}
.zwdh dl dt{ border-bottom:1px #25B91A dotted; line-height:25px;font-weight:bold; }
.zwdh dl dd{ height:100px; overflow:auto;}
.zwdh dl dd ul{ line-height:22px; }
.main_r{ float:right; width:198px; display:table;}
.main_r h2{ background:url(imagesser_bg.jpg); width:196px; height:28px; line-height:28px;}
.main_r h2 span{ margin-left:10px; color:#fff; float:left;}
.main_r ul{ background:url(imagesnot_bg.jpg) repeat-x top; padding:6px 10px; width:176px; line-height:24px;}
.main_r ol{ background:url(imagesnot_bg.jpg) repeat-x top;padding:6px 10px; *padding:4px 10px; width:176px; line-height:24px; display:table;}
.main_r ul li{background:url(imagesicon_1.gif) no-repeat left; width:176px;}
.main_r ul li a{ margin-left:10px;}
.main_r ol li{ background:url(imagessev_ul.jpg) no-repeat; width:80px;height:81px; _height:84px; float:left;margin: 4px 6px 3px 2px; *margin:3px 8px 3px 2px;_margin:2px 3px 1px 2px; text-align:center;}
.main_r ol li img{margin:15px auto 10px; *margin:15px auto 13px;}
.main_r ol li a{ color:#fff;}
.hf{ width:196px; border:1px #C1D5AF solid; height:184px; display:table;}
.sevice{ width:196px; border:1px #C1D5AF solid; margin-top:6px; height:558px; display:table;}
.bottom{ width:960px; margin:6px auto 0; background:url(imagesbottom1.jpg); display:table;font-size:12px;text-align:center;line-height:22px; padding:6px 0; color:#fff;}
.bottom a{ color:#fff;}
.list{ width:950px;margin:6px auto; display:table;}
#list_l{ width:186px; border:1px #ACBC86 solid; border-bottom:0; float:left;display:table;}
#list_l1{ width:186px; background:#CADAA7;border:1px #ACBC86 solid; padding-bottom:6px;display:table;}
#list_l1 h2{ background:url(imageslist_h2.gif); margin:6px auto 0; color:#fff; text-align:center; width:171px; height:50px; line-height:50px;}
#list_l1 ul{ margin:0 auto; background:#1CA71C; border-right:3px #178B17 solid;border-bottom:3px #178B17 solid;  width:168px; display:table;}
#list_l1 ul li{ background:url(imageslist_li.gif); width:150px; height:32px; line-height:32px; margin:0 auto; }
#list_l1 ul li a{ color:#025B95; font-size:14px; float:left; color:#fff;}
#list_l1 ul li img{ float:left; margin:12px 10px 0 10px;}
#list_l ol img{ margin:5px auto; display:block;}
#list_l ol{ text-align:center; background:#F1F5E8; border-bottom:1px #ccc solid; padding:5px 0;}
#list_r{ float:right;width:754px;}
#list_r h2{width:754px;height:28px; line-height:28px; background:#F2F4F3;font-size:12px;font-weight:normal;}
#list_r h2 span{background:url(../images/online_l.jpg) no-repeat left top;display:block; text-indent:20px;}
#list_r h2 img,.adr img{ float:left; margin:0 -8px;}
#list_r h2 img,.adr img{ margin:5px 0 0 10px;} 
#list_r ul{ margin:10px 0 10px 10px;}
#list_r ul li{ background:url(imagesicon_1.gif) no-repeat left center; border-bottom:1px #ccc dotted; padding-bottom:3px;  width:720px; line-height:25px;height:25px; display:table;}
#list_r ul li a,.con ul li a{ float:left; margin-left:15px;}
#list_r ul li span,.con ul li span{ float:right; margin-right:10px;}
#list_r ol{ border:1px #DBDED2 solid; background:#F5F5F2; text-align:center; font-size:12px;}
#list_r ol img{ vertical-align:middle; margin-right:10px;}
#list_r ol input{ border:1px #d0d0d0 solid; _margin-top:5px; width:25px;}
#list_r ol li{ height:30px; line-height:30px;}
#list_r ol li a{ margin:0 10px;}
#list_r ol li a:hover{ color:#f00; text-decoration:none;}
.con{width:950px;background:url(imagescon_bg.gif) repeat-x top;margin:10px auto 0; margin:6px auto;display:table;}
.adr{background:#F2F4F3; text-indent:20px; width:950px;height:28px;line-height:28px; font-size:12px; font-weight:normal; margin:6px auto; float:lift}
.adr span{ display:block;}
.con_news{ width:950px; display:table; overflow:hidden;}
.con_news1{margin:34px 30px; }
.con_bot{ width:952px; margin:0 auto; display:block;}
.con h1{ color:#000;font-family:黑体;font-size:22px;line-height:140%;font-weight:normal;text-align:center;letter-spacing:2px;padding:10px 0; margin:0 auto; }
.con h2{ text-align:center; background:url(imagescon_h2.gif) no-repeat top; padding-top:15px; font-size:12px; color:#999; font-weight:normal; margin:10px auto 20px;}
.con h2 span{ margin:0 15px;}
.con ul li {background:url(imagesicon_1.gif) no-repeat left; width:860px; line-height:20px; height:20px; display:table; }
.con h3{ background:#EDEFEE;font-size:12px; text-indent:20px; line-height:25px; width:90%; margin:0 auto; }
.con p img{ margin:0 auto; text-align:center;}
.con p{font-family:仿宋_GB2312;font-style:normal;font-weight:normal;letter-spacing:2px;border-color:normal;border-style:none;border-width:0px;vertical-align:baseline;table-layout:auto; color:#000; font-size:16pt;}
.con ul{ margin:10px auto 10px 50px; line-height:20px;}

.list_news{border-top:0; display:table;}
.list_news1{border-top:0; display:table;width:754px;}
.tabletitle{ width:98%; margin:6px auto; display:table;  line-height:25px;}
.table1{ margin:6px auto; width:98%; line-height:25px; line-height:25px;} 
.textarea1{ border:1px #ccc solid;}
.menu ul,li {
 margin:0px;
 padding:0px;
 list-style:none;
}
.menu {
 width:1003px;
}
.menu li {
 font-size:14px;
 color:#fff;
 font-weight:bold;
 font-family:"微软雅黑", 
 list-style:none;
 float:left;
 line-height:43px;
 width:98px;
 text-align:center;
 margin-top:0px;
}
.menu li a {
 display:block;
 color:#fff;
 padding:0px 0px;
}
.menu li a:hover {
 display:block;
 background:url(imagesdh_images_qh.png) no-repeat;
 color:#e60002;
}
.menu .current {
 background:url(imagesdh_images_qh.png) no-repeat;
 color:#e60002;
 text-align:center;
}
.menu .current a {
 display:block;
 color:#e60002;text-decoration:none}
.menu .current a:hover {
 display:block;
 color:#e60002;text-decoration:none}
.menu .dh_line{
width:3px;
height:33px;
margin-left:3px;
margin-right:3px;
background-image:url(../images/line_fg.png)
}

 .fl ul,li { margin:0px; padding:0px; list-style:none;}
 .fl { width:162px; padding-left:10px}
 .fl li { font-size:12px;color:#000; float:left; line-height:24px;width:70px;text-align:center; margin-top:1px;}
 .fl li a { display:block;padding:0px 0px; background: url(imagesfile_a.jpg); width:70px; height:24px; line-height:24px; color:#000;}
 .fl li a:hover { display:block; background:url(imagesfile_cho1.jpg); width:70px; height:24px; line-height:24px;color:#066deb;}
 .fl .current {color:#b00007; text-align:center;background:url(imagesfile_cho1.jpg); width:70px; height:24px; line-height:24px;}
 .fl .current a{ display:block;font-weight:bold; color:#ffffff;background:url(imagesfile_cho1.jpg); width:66px; height:24px; line-height:24px;}
 .fl .current a:hover { display:block; font-weight:bold;color:#ffffff; background:url(imagesfile_cho1.jpg); width:66px; height:24px; line-height:24px;} 
 